[root@1-min etc]# cat -n rsyslog.conf//显示所有行号(包括空行)

[root@1-min etc]# cat -b rsyslog.conf              //显示所有行号(但不包括空行)

或者:

[root@1-min etc]# nl -ba rsyslog.conf              //显示所有行号(包括空行)

[root@1-min etc]# nl -bt rsyslog.conf              //显示所有行号(但不包括空行)

再或者:

[root@1-min etc]# less -N rsyslog.conf             //显示所有行号(包括空行)

cat 选项:

-n   显示行号(包括空行)

-b   显示行号(不包括空行)

nl 选项:

-b 行的显示方式

//行的显示方式有两种,a表示显示全部的行(包括空行),t表示显示所有的非空白行(不包括空行)

即:-ba            //显示所有行号(包括空行)

-bt            //显示所有行号(但不包括空行)

另外还有些东西跟行号有关,这里也列举下:

■ cat命令

● 默认 选项

如图所示:

● -A 选项

显示文件内容,显示^I标记(Tab键),显示$标记(换行符)。

● -b 选项

显示文本行号,空行不包含在内。如图所示:

● -e 选项

显示文本行,同时显示换行标记$符号。

● -E 选项

在每行的结尾显示$符号。

● -n 选项

每行都显示行号,空行也包括在内。

● -T 选项

显示Tab键,标记为^I。

● -s选项

当遇到大于两行以上空白时,压缩只显示一行。

■ more命令

● -num 选项

指定一个整数,例如num=2,表示当前屏幕一次显示文本的行数。

可见,只显示了2行文本,单击空格键继续显示。

● -d 选项

当一屏显示不下文件内容的时候,在屏幕下方提示按键操作:Press space to continue,'q' to quit。

● -num 选项

● +/ 选项

在+/后面可以输入匹配的字符串,如果指定文件中不存在,则提示,否则直接显示对应字符串所在的行。

字符串out在f.java文件中存在,执行more +/out f.java,则直接显示内容。

单击空格键,显示f.java文件内容。

■ less命令

less命令类似于more命令,但是less命令可以想vi编辑器一样。比如输入命令:

less hello.c f.java

最下面一行说明了,下一个文件是f.java,直接键入:n就可以显示f.java文件的内容

在此模式下,输入命令:p可以查看前一个文件hello.c。

关于less命令,可以直接输入man less命令查看帮助手册。

■ head命令

● 默认 选项

不指定任何选项的时候,比如执行head f.java,则显示f.java文件的全部内容。

● -n 选项

显示指定文件的前n行,n为一个整数。

显示了f.java文件的前两行。

另外,可以显示多个文件的头部信息(指定前n行)

■ tail命令

● 默认 选项

不指定任何选项的时候,比如执行tail f.java,则显示f.java文件的全部内容。

● -n 选项

显示指定文件的后n行,n为一个整数。

显示了f.java文件的后4行。

另外,可以显示多个文件的尾部信息(指定后n行)。

linux带行号显示数据,linux中查看文件时显示行号相关推荐

  1. linux查看文件时显示行号,linux中查看文件时显示行号

    linux中查看文件时显示行号 [root@1-min etc]# cat -n rsyslog.conf              //显示所有行号(包括空行) [root@1-min etc]# ...

  2. linux怎么查看内容并显示行号,linux中查看文件时显示行号

    Linux中查看文件时显示行号 [[email protected] etc]# cat -n rsyslog.conf              //显示所有行号(包括空行) [[email pro ...

  3. Linux系列:linux中查看文件时显示行号

    cat -n rsyslog.conf              //显示所有行号(包括空行) less -N rsyslog.conf             //显示所有行号(包括空行) vi 时 ...

  4. 在python中读取文件时如何去除行末的换行符以及在Windows与Linux中的区别

    [时间]2018.11.14 [题目]在python中读取文件时如何去除行末的换行符以及在Windows与Linux中的区别 一.去除换行符 以使用readline进行读取为例: import red ...

  5. linux查看光纤卡微码版本,各操作系统中查看HBA 光纤卡 WWN 号的方法汇总

    各操作系统中查看HBA 光纤卡 WWN 号的方法汇总 我们在日常的工作中经常需要查询HBA卡的WWN号,可是客户的HBA卡已经安装到服务器,且也没有交换机,在存储上看到很多WWN号,不知道主机对应的H ...

  6. Linux基本命令的记录(vi命令,查看文件内容,显示进程,切换用户等)

    一.vi是linux系统上常用的一个文本编辑器,其有三种模式:命令模式.编辑模式(插入模式).末行模式. 命令模式-->编辑模式:"i a o I A O" 编辑模式--&g ...

  7. Linux中复制前10kb的数据,linux基本操作

    linux简介 linux 是一套操作系统 Linux系统内核为linux. 内核是一个电脑程序组成操作系统的核心,链接系统硬件和应用程序. Linux系统是自由和开源的. 连接linux集群 将多个 ...

  8. Linux系统中查看文件的几种方式

    Linux系统中查看文件的几种方式 0. 准备工作 1. 使用vim命令:查看并编辑文件 2. 使用cat命令:一次性显示文件的所有内容 3. 使用head 命令:显示文件开头 4. 使用tail 命 ...

  9. linux命令 - tail:查看文件最后几行的命令

    Linux查看文件最后几行的命令 - 宗炳煌 - 博客园 https://www.cnblogs.com/xiaozong/p/5307878.html tail -n 20 filename 说明: ...

最新文章

  1. Pytorch中的数据加载
  2. 第十五章 深入分析iBatis框架之系统架构与映射原理(待续)
  3. 【笔记】微软OneNote使用笔记,OneNote备份问题
  4. React里require('object-assign')里的实现原理
  5. 2018-2019-2 《Java程序设计》第6周学习总结
  6. [******] 树问题:普通二叉树的创建与遍历
  7. php 未实例化类调用方法的问题
  8. 分布式mysql 不支持存储过程_分布式数据库VoltDB对存储过程的支持
  9. 腐蚀单机服务器怎么不稳定,腐蚀有什么指令?基本指令及服务器指令汇总
  10. Windows 7集成IE11(离线安装包、补丁)
  11. 数据库系统概念第六版 第八章练习题 2 3 9
  12. android模拟键盘自动输入,Android测试教程5--模拟键盘输入
  13. 笔记之PWM暂停输出,保持低电平问题
  14. STM32F4之按键(二)
  15. Linux常用终端命令
  16. for循环和range函数
  17. WADISWAT数据处理
  18. Glide 4.9源码解析-缓存策略
  19. go源码阅读——malloc.go
  20. 西邮linux兴趣小组2019,2020补纳面试题

热门文章

  1. 按钮-button元素
  2. PC微信机器人之实战分析微信发送xml名片消息call
  3. win10怎么把网络里面计算机删除,win10系统删除网络共享中多余的计算机的修复技巧...
  4. pygame飞机大战用精灵组(sprite)的层(layer)编写(八)BOSS要花样,更多花样(附代码资源下载链接)
  5. vue.js项目实战运用篇之抖音视频APP-第一节:项目环境搭建
  6. 【数据库】sqlserver查询数据库锁
  7. 天池工业蒸汽量预测-模型调参
  8. Jenkins持续集成安卓 Android
  9. Go Map有序输出
  10. 飞贷app,资金从银行到生意人